Lambros Charissis

  • Citations Per Year
Learn More
The Connected-Car Prototyping Platform provides both a back end for applications interacting with connected cars and an abstraction of such connected devices for developers. It also provides services such as identity management and data storage. Its main purposes are experimentation, prototyping, evaluation of ideas, and reduction of time-to-market for(More)
For many years, software engineering researchers and practitioners have tried to determine, define, and redefine the role of software architects. But we still haven't reached a real consensus. The popularity of agile methods such as Scrum and Kanban, with their clear focus on team collaboration, threatens many roles traditionally assigned to individual(More)
As cars turn into computers on wheels, it becomes vital to experiment with novel application scenarios and to envision suitable abstractions for integrating cars into existing enterprise information systems. This insightful project report tells the story of a prototyping platform for connectedcar software and shares the project’s experience with a(More)
  • 1